本家のお世話-#114。(PHP5.6.7へアップデート)

投稿アップデート情報  追記(4/14)

 Windows 版の PHP5.6.7 が Mar-19 23:50:34UTC に出ていた。結構な数のバグフィックスと CVE-2015-0231 (bug #68976), CVE-2015-2305 (bug #69248), CVE-2015-2331 (bug #69253) へのパッチが含まれているようだ。
 CVE-2015-0231 については,以前の PHP5.6.5 でも修正が入っていた覚えがあるのだが,この脆弱性に対する問題はまだまだ残っているのだろうか。まっ,とにかく,アップデートした。(サーバ OS : Windows7HP+SP1(x86)).

 ところで,新バージョンは OPcache に関するいくつかのバグフィックスを含んでいた。もっとも, Bug #67937 ではなんら新しい報告はないので,あの件に関しては何も変わっていないのかもしれないが,一応,試しに OPcache をサーバ上で有効にしてみた (Mar-29@6:55)。吉と出るか凶と出るか。ドキドキ。

 インストールについて詳しい情報が必要な場合は,「PHP 5.5.16 から PHP 5.6.0 への移行」をご覧ください。

追記(4/14):
 自鯖上の OPcache だが,あれ以来 2 週間以上ちゃんと動いている。なんでかは解んない(汗)。でも,パフォーマンスが良くなって,嬉しいッ!!

桃の節句も過ぎて。

 我が家では,いまだ梅の花が満開ですが(図 1 ,図 2 ),桃の節句も過ぎ,巷には桃の花やら杏の花やら目立ってきました。桃の節句と言えば,今年はひな壇になるチロルチョコレートを,ひと箱もらいましたよ。図 3 みたいなのです。

図 1 白梅
図 1 白梅
図 2 紅梅
図 2 紅梅
図 3 ひな飾り
図 3 ひな飾り

 そんなこんなで,春の詩を詠じたくなっちゃいました。白居易(樂天)の「春風」を選んでみましたが,いかがでしょうか?

亦 薺 櫻 一
道 花 杏 枝
春 楡 桃 先
風 莢 梨 發
爲 深 次 苑
我 村 第 中
來 裏 開 梅

のろし。

 3/1 に Delonix から ‘Smoke signals’ という件名のメールが来た,he-he。彼の言うことには,「毎回,次のメッセージが出るようになっちゃったんだけど: Forbidden You don’t have permission to access / on this server. Additionally, a 403 Forbidden error was encountered while trying to use an ErrorDocument to handle the request.」。これって 403 Forbidden のデフォルトメッセージだよね。

 彼には, o6asanの掲示板の英語版に新トピックを立ててもらって, access-denied.conf ファイルを確認した。自鯖のアクセス管理は conf ファイルでやっている。 .htaccess でやるほうが普通だと思うけど。まあとにかく,ファイルん中に彼のカレント IP があったんで,削除した。ちゃんとアクセスできるようになったみたい。

403 Forbidden Delonix とはときどきメールのやり取りをするので,こんな方法で連絡がついたが,それほど近しくないビジターのためには,やっぱ, 403 Forbidden メッセージのカスタマイズをやっとかんといかんなということで, 403.html ファイルをこさえた。中には右図のようなことを書いた。

 これを使うためには,ちゃんと表示ができないといけないので, access-denied.conf ファイルに下記の太字行を書き加え, Apache httpd をリブートした。
<Directory “G:/WEB”>   <<— G:/WEB は自鯖のドキュメントルート
<RequireAll>
Require all granted
Require not ip xxx.xxx.xxx.xxx/xx
Require not ip yyy.yyy.yyy.yyy/yy
</RequireAll>
<Files “403.html”>
Require all granted
</Files>

</Directory>

 以上!!